The Lost Paradise
This course delves into the history of Al-Andalus, from the Islamic conquest of Iberia in 711 CE to the expulsion of the Moriscos in 1609. Students will explore its political, cultural, and intellectual contributions to the Islamic world and Europe, while reflecting on lessons of resilience and coexistence. Through primary sources, expert-led sessions, and discussions, participants will gain insights into one of history’s most remarkable civilizations and its enduring legacy.
